Finding Your Tribe
Radha reflects on her journey of self-discovery, emphasizing the critical importance of surrounding oneself with the right people. At 30, she experienced an enlightening moment that prompted her to evaluate her friendships and the life she was leading. By creating a list of qualities she sought in friends, she began to prioritize meaningful connections over convenience, ultimately leading to a more fulfilling life.In this clip
